* Emacs関連 [#me83ab77]

** コマンドなど [#db7ceb9b]
*** 改行 [#va4542b3]
C-q jで改行を意味する。探索、置換等で改行を一つの文字として扱う場合に用いる。
*** C-M-*の意味 [#d6d0d040]
メタキーを押してから、C-*。順序が変だが、Emacsの伝統であるよう。

** 正規表現関連 [#pdee705d]
*** 正規表現の置換 [#vbfd8750]
M-x replace-regexpを使う。
正規表現に自信のない場合、インクリメンタルサーチで照合をチェックしてからやるのがよい。

*** 正規表現のインクリメンタルサーチ [#ycecb988]
C-M-s(前向き)、C-M-r(後ろ向き)

*** 正規表現の使用例 [#d30b481f]
- グルーピング(\(....\))と参照(\1, \2, ...)~
0以外の数字に対して、末尾の0を削りたい場合、
 M-x replace-regexp \([0-9][0-9]*\)0 \1


トップ   編集 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S